Frequently asked

How many people live in Palm Desert, California?

Palm Desert, California has about 23,252 residents according to the 1990 Census.

What is the median household income in Palm Desert, California?

The typical household in Palm Desert, California earns about $37,315 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Palm Desert, California expensive?

In Palm Desert, California, the median home is worth about $172,300, and the typical rent is about $696 a month.

How educated are people in Palm Desert, California?

About 23.6% of adults age 25 and over in Palm Desert, California h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Palm Desert, California?

About 7.1% of people in Palm Desert, California live below the federal poverty line.
